Australian IT: Linux Heads Uptown
Jul 13, 2004, 03 :15 UTC (0 Talkback[s]) (5502 reads)

(Other stories by Simon Hayes)

"Len Carver is a practical man. He has decided it isn't worth trying to prise accountants away from Microsoft Excel, or to cure lawyers of their addiction to Microsoft Word.

"The chief information officer of internet search and directory company Sensis isn't about to pick a fight he's likely to lose, nor is he wedded to the concept of rolling out open-source applications without a strong idea of how they will cut costs and make people's jobs easier..."
